Marajó: Francis Is Confronted With a Wall

The faithful of the Apostolic Prelature of Marajó (Brazil) have announced that they will not welcome the new bishop unless the expulsion of Mgr José Azconais revoked.

Hundreds of them have signed an open letter warning that the installation of the new bishop, Mgr José Ionilton, could be seriously jeopardised.

On 9th December it was announced that the Apostolic Nuncio in Brazil, Mgr Giambattista Diquattro, had called Mgr Azcona to inform him that he could no longer reside in the territory of the Prelature. The Nuncio didn't give any reasons for his decision.
